Picking them up  I know handling reptiles causes some stress...however i wanted to pick up my bigger tokay (not my smaller one cause my room is too messy to catch the smaller one if he gets out of my grip) at least once a week...is there a way to do it?....Like do i slowly grab it at the neck then support the waist? so this way i don’t get bit?

Picking them up  no never grab a reptile by the neck when you are picking them up try just putting your hand in there, if they feel they are in no danger they should come up to you, or you could just pick em up put your hand under the belly and just pick em up and use 2 hands so they don’t jump and hurt themselves, just never pick them up by the tail.

Picking them up  On the caresheet that I got from the breeder of mine says to put your hand out so they can walk onto it. I’m sure the lizard would be less stressed out if it was his/her choice to be held

Picking them up  Just for the record, Smiley has been with me for over a year, but he was pretty vicious when I first got him. Took him little over six months too stop biting off my knuckles. Now he’s practically cuddly(for a reptile). Just have patience, and be careful for your sake and your Tokay’s.
